Offshore and Naval Architecture (co-operative)

In this co-operative (apprentice) engineer specialization, the skills developed concern the structure, design and propulsion of ships.
Career Opportunities

Engineers in charge of new builds (production engineer, integrator, head of “methods”…) engineers in charge of the maintenance and repair of ships.

Program
  • structure design and sizing
  • ship propulsion (motorization and propulsion train)
  • naval hydrodynamics
  • regulations, reference frameworks and standards in force in the field of naval construction and repairs

By the end of their training, the graduates will be able to:

  • carry out design, production, integration and maintenance activities of assemblies or sub-assemblies, onboard equipment and motorization in a ship or offshore construction yard, or in a naval study office or for a naval architect.

  • Adapt to most computer aided manufacturing and design systems.

Examples of final year projects accomplished (6 month mission in company)

  • Design of a careening barge for Alpha Techniques.
  • Mastery of gaseous releases onboard submarines for Naval Group.
  • Design of a versatile offshore service vessel for Chantier Allais.
  • Submarine transfer and launch system for Naval Group.
  • Design of a 12m netter/potter fishing boat for the Archi Delion Office.
  • Integration of the helicopter function onboard an Offshore Patrol Vessel for OCEA S.A.
  • Deputy site manager – Monitoring of a national naval vessel maintenance availability for CNN-MCO.
